Text to Image
Drop a photo, type text, drag it where you want. 20+ fonts, full color control, no upload required. Browser-side from start to finish.
Drop a photo to start
JPG, PNG, WebP, HEIC up to 40 MB · stays in your browser
Never uploaded · 100% browser-side
How it works
- 1
Drop your photo
Drag & drop or browse to upload your image.
- 2
Type and style your text
Pick a font, size, color, weight - then drag the text to the right position on your photo.
- 3
Download or open in editor
Save the result with text baked in, or jump into our AI editor for more edits.
Why use this online tool
20+ fonts ready to use
Display, sans-serif, handwriting, serif - covers every casual or professional layout style.
Drag-to-place editing
Move and resize text directly on the photo. No coordinate math, no menu hunting.
Privacy-first
Photo and text stay in your browser. No upload, no server processing, no privacy risk.
Free, no watermark
Unlimited text overlays, no signup, no overlay branding on the output.
When to use it
- Quick memes and reaction images for messaging or social
- Quote cards and motivational posts for Instagram or Pinterest
- Photo captions with location, date, or names
- Watermarking your own work with a text signature
- Annotating screenshots for tutorials, bug reports, or design feedback
Frequently asked questions
- What fonts are available?
- 20+ fonts across 5 categories: Display (Anton, Bebas Neue, Bungee, Lobster, Oswald, Pacifico, Righteous, Syne), Sans-serif (Inter, Montserrat, Nunito, Poppins, Raleway, Space Grotesk), Handwriting (Caveat, Dancing Script, Playwrite), Serif (Fraunces, Playfair), and System fonts.
- Can I use multiple text layers?
- Yes - add as many text layers as you need. Each can have its own font, size, color, and position. Drag any layer to reposition independently.
- Can I curve or rotate the text?
- Rotation - yes, drag the rotation handle on the selected text. Curved text isn't in this widget yet, but you can open the result in our full editor for advanced text effects.
- Will the text be sharp on retina screens?
- Yes - text is rendered at the image's native resolution. There's no down-scaling, so the result is crisp at any display density.
- Can I add a shadow or outline to text?
- Shadow yes, outline coming soon. The shadow toggle in the panel adds a subtle drop-shadow that improves legibility on busy backgrounds.
- Does the original photo get changed?
- No - the text is composited onto a copy. The download is the new image with text baked in; your source file is untouched.
Related free tools
Frame to Photo
Pick a frame style and apply it instantly. Polaroid, film strip, neon glow, gradient borders, and more. Browser-side, no upload.
Vintage Filter
Give any photo a warm, faded retro look in one click. Tune the intensity to taste. 100% browser-side, no upload.
Crop to Square (1:1)
Crop your photo to a perfect 1:1 square instantly. Choose what stays in frame with the draggable crop box. Browser-side, no upload.
Compress Image Online
Shrink your photo's file size without losing visible quality. Compare before/after sizes in real time. Browser-side, no upload.
Need more than just text to image?
Our AI editor goes way beyond simple transforms - background removal, style transfer, upscaling, photo-to-anime, and 50+ more AI tools. First 5 edits are on us.
Open AI editor - 5 free credits